A Presque Isle woman who recently released a book on the scandalous Maine child-care system has struck publicity gold.
Sabrina Rose has been selected to appear on Kevin Lanningโs Apple podcast later this spring.
โRise Above with Kevin Lanningโ is a worldwide-popular show focused on stories of recovery from addiction and resilience.
Lanning, a former Google executive, overcame addiction to finally claim sobriety.
Rose, who had hired a PR agent to publicize her story, decided to instead do it on her own, single-handedly nabbing a slot on his show.
โIโve been booked to appear on one of the biggest podcasts in the world,โ she said. โIโll be traveling to Palm Beach soon to tell the whole world my story.โ
Rose, 31, last month broke onto the public stage exposing Maineโs troubled child-welfare system with the publishing of her second memoir, โFinding Michelle Canu.โ
The search for her mother meshed with a parallel mission – investigating state officials taking custody of children in difficult circumstances and placing them in worse conditions.
The government rocket scientists separated Rose from her siblings at a young age and stuck her with abusive foster parent.
From the unmitigated trauma came drug and alcohol abuse, yet Rose somehow found the self-determination to survive.
Once she bloodied her knuckles painfully unearthing impossible-to-find adoption records revealing her past, survival slowly merged into personal growth.
โFor years, I was told to hate my mother,โ she said. โI was told to hate her because of her heroin addiction. And I did, up until recentlyโฆ
โTen years after my mothers death, I uncovered the whole story as to why my mother gave me up for adoption. The truth was so profound, so shocking, that I wrote a book about it.โ
As Rose slowly overcame her addictions, she also began reconnecting with her brother and sister and found faith – in herself.
On the upcoming podcast, โwe will be discussing how DHHS almost destroyed my life – and killed my mother,โ she said, referring to the Maine Department of Health and Human Services.
As Rose excitedly awaits her trip to Palm Beach, โmore podcast guest appearances of mine will be popping up. Iโm so excited, humbled, and grateful,โ she said.
